Oil of oregano supplement has surged in popularity as a natural approach to supporting everyday wellness. Extracted from the leaves and flowers of Origanum vulgare, this concentrated extract delivers active compounds like carvacrol and thymol. These constituents are the reason many people turn to oregano oil for targeted immune and digestive support.
Understanding the Active Compounds
The strength of oil of oregano largely depends on its concentration of phenolic compounds. Carvacrol and thymol are the primary elements studied for their biological activity. These molecules contribute to the character of the oil and are the focus of ongoing research. Consistent potency relies on standardized extraction methods that preserve these beneficial constituents.

Combatting Fungal Overgrowth
The antifungal properties of oregano oil make it a popular choice for addressing yeast imbalances. Compounds in the oil disrupt the cell membranes of fungi, limiting their spread. This is particularly useful for managing candida overgrowth in the gut and elsewhere. Consistent use, alongside a low-sugar diet, enhances these effects.
Usage and Safety Considerations
Due to its potency, oil of oregano supplement should never be taken in undiluted form. Enteric-coated capsules are recommended to protect the stomach lining and ensure delivery to the intestines. Following the dosage instructions on the label prevents irritation and optimizes absorption. Consulting a healthcare provider is wise for long-term use or for those on medication.
Choosing a High-Quality Product
Not all oregano oil supplements are created equal. Look for products that specify the carvacrol percentage on the label. Organic certification ensures the herb is free from synthetic pesticides and additives. A reliable brand provides third-party lab results for potency and purity.
